Abstract

Efficient energy utilization in wireless sensor networks (WSN) is one of the factors that improves network performance. Recent works have focused on energy-aware routing protocols or topology control to improve energy efficiency at each sensor node. However, these studies separate routing and topology control. This can result in the fact that if an optimal topology is obtained, the data transmission routes may not be optimal and vice versa. To overcome this problem, we propose a routing-based topology control algorithm to obtain an optimal network topology and data transmission route set. Our idea is to use the integer linear programming (ILP) problem to formulate the routing problem with the objective function of optimizing two metrics: the distance of the routes and node degree of the topology. The constraints include the traffic load on the wireless links and desired node degree. By solving this ILP problem to determine a set of data transmission routes, the transmission power of the sensor nodes is simultaneously determined based on its routing table to optimize the network topology. The simulation results show that the proposed algorithm outperforms well-known topology control algorithms in terms of the desired node order and energy efficiency.
